Gene Street Group, a leading trading firm, has announced a bid to lease a new office in the British capital, London. This offer comes at a time when the company is experiencing significant growth, enabling it to double its presence in the UK market.
Founded in 2000, Gene Street aims to enhance its operational capabilities in London, reflecting its commitment to expanding its business in global financial markets. The new office will provide larger space to meet its increasing needs for staff and technology.

Background & Context
Gene Street was established in New York and has successfully built a strong reputation as one of the leading quantitative trading firms. With the growing demand for its services, the company decided to expand its operations to meet the changing market needs. London is considered one of the most important financial markets in the world, making it an ideal destination for expansion.
Over the years, London has seen many changes in its business environment, including the impacts of Brexit. However, the city still retains its status as a major financial center, making it attractive for companies like Gene Street.
